Toolverse
Wszystkie skille

nodejs-best-practices

autor: davila7

Naucz się myśleć o architekturze Node.js, nie tylko kopiuj kod

Instalacja

Wybierz klienta i sklonuj repozytorium do odpowiedniego katalogu skilli.

Instalacja

Szybkie info

Autor
davila7
Wyświetlenia
59

O skillu

Umiejętność do Claude'a, która uczy zasad tworzenia aplikacji Node.js w 2025 roku. Dowiesz się, jak wybierać między frameworkami (Express, Fastify, Hono, NestJS) na podstawie kontekstu projektu, obsługiwać asynchroniczne operacje, wdrażać bezpieczeństwo i projektować architekturę. Zamiast gotowych szablonów otrzymujesz wiedzę o procesie decyzyjnym — kiedy użyć którego narzędzia i dlaczego.

Jak używać

  1. Zainstaluj umiejętność w swoim środowisku Claude'a, wskazując na repozytorium davila7/claude-code-templates. Umiejętność wymaga dostępu do narzędzi Read, Write, Edit, Glob i Grep.

  2. Opisz Claude'owi swój projekt: co budujesz, gdzie będzie wdrożone (edge, serverless, serwer tradycyjny), czy masz ograniczenia wydajności i jakie ma doświadczenie Twój zespół.

  3. Claude będzie zadawać pytania, aby zrozumieć kontekst — odpowiadaj szczerze o celach, ograniczeniach i preferencjach. Nie ma uniwersalnej odpowiedzi; wybór zależy od sytuacji.

  4. Na podstawie Twoich odpowiedzi Claude zaproponuje framework i wzorce asynchroniczne, wyjaśniając uzasadnienie każdej decyzji. Otrzymasz porównanie opcji (np. Hono vs Fastify vs Express), a nie tylko jeden przepis.

  5. Pytaj o szczegóły: bezpieczeństwo (walidacja, autoryzacja), moduły (ESM vs CommonJS), TypeScript bez kroku budowania (Node.js 22+) lub inne aspekty architektury. Claude będzie wskazywać zasady, a nie gotowy kod.

  6. Stosuj zdobytą wiedzę do swojego projektu. Umiejętność uczy myślenia — to Ty podejmujesz ostateczne decyzje na podstawie zrozumienia, a nie ślepego naśladowania.

Podobne skille